Subject: Handover — Pixelwash EXIF scrubber

Taking PTO starting tomorrow. Pixelwash 2.4 ships Thursday. The EXIF scrubbing job now strips GPS and serial tags before CDN upload; verify the scrub-audit dashboard stays green after deploy. If the batch worker stalls, restart it once before paging imaging. Rollback is the 2.3.9 tag, already staged. Release artifacts must be signed before promotion. Use the deploy key below.

rollout seal: bky9_PeXH1fTLY

// Default tail window for the `peekly` log CLI. On-call folks: 500 lines
// keeps the Harkness gateway from choking during incident spikes, so
// resist the urge to crank it. If you need more, use --since instead.
// The binary you should be running reports the build token below.

build token for kagaf-hahof: htk14_9d3d4d26d7d8de

Finance Review Summary — Pellward Instruments Board Pack

The Aurelis product line shows gross margin compression of 3.2 points, driven by component costs and unchecked channel discounting. A structured price uplift of 5–7% is modelled as sustainable given low churn sensitivity. Finance recommends phased implementation with quarterly checkpoints. The proposed approach is summarised below.

confidential, yagep-kagef: Rusvanox Holdings is in early talks to buy Julwynix Systems for about $454.5 million. The Fenael launch date is April 23, and nothing goes to the press before then. Legal wants the Druwynix Works term sheet redrafted before January 8.

## Static-Analysis Baseline

Welcome aboard. The repo ships with `lintbase.json`, a baseline file that suppresses pre-existing findings from the Quillcheck analyzer so your PRs only flag new issues. Don't regenerate it casually — that resets the baseline and buries real regressions. If you must, run `quillcheck --rebaseline` and get sign-off from the Harrowgate platform team. Quillcheck uploads results to the central dashboard, and that upload step authenticates with a project key, which goes in your `.env` on the line below.

sealed setting: ARCHIVE_KEY3=8d0